Быстрый лёгкий надёжный форумный движок
Вы не вошли.
Страницы 1
Тема закрыта
Как это сделать?
Удалить папку /lang/English и сменить дефолтовое значение в БД с English на Russian в users.language
А разве дефолтовое значение из админа не задать? Обязательно в базу лезть?
РПо дефлту в админке делается. Но зарегённый юзер если не удалить инглиш сможет его выбрать после регистрациив профиле. Тебе чё надо то? Удалить или по дефолту поставить? Если удалить то тебе ответили вполне логично.
Поле language в таблице users по умолчанию принимает значение English, это заложено в логику, т.е. если явно не указать язык он станет английским, не зависимо от того есть он в действительности или нет и независимо от настроек в админке. Я имел в виду именно этот момент. Соответственно чтобы это исправить нужно в дополнение к настройкам из админки (что само собой) исправить дефолтовое значение этого поля language в таблице users на Russian. Хотя в принципе это и не обязательно, поскольку при регистрации нового пользователя ему подставляется дефолтовый язык выставленный через админку, но тем не менее база данных будет по прежнему иметь структуру таблицы с полем
language varchar(25) not null default "English"
А точно если этот момент.
Тогда можно просто в папку инглиш залить русский language
Т.е. название папки оставить "English" а на самом деле туда залить русские файлы.
Но тогда в опциях выбора языка будет маячить English
Спасибо все понял.
Страницы 1
Тема закрыта